Read moreIn last week’s edition of the Citizen in the FFA coverage section, the buyers of Jase Rau’s Reserve champion market hog were listed as Bill and Hadley Sciba. While the attribution of two in the photo was correct, they were there representing the actual buyers, 1st State Bank.
